We are looking for a senior estimator to join our Procurement team.
Job Purpose
The senior Estimator is responsible for planning, organizing, and fully developing comprehensive conceptual and final costing estimates from the start to the completion of varied civil construction projects. This position works with the Project Procurement team in the delivery of a total bid price for heavy civil general contracts in both conventional tender and design-build formats. This position may also act as the Technical Lead on Design-Build Projects, and if successful, act as Project Manager throughout project execution.

Key Tasks And Responsabilities
- Review contractual documents and contract modifications to determine the scope of work.
- Review specifications and drawings and attend pre-bid meetings to determine the scope of work and required contents of estimates.
- Prepare accurate takeoff quantities using Autodesk QTO takeoff application.
- Prepare estimates using B2W estimating system calculating material, labor, and equipment costs and applying them to complete the scope of work.
- Prepare, issue, receive and review supplier and subcontractor proposals and pricing.
- Review options based on design and recommend the best solution based on cost competitiveness.
- Assist proposal manager in preparing bid package documents.
- Negotiate and manage the bid award process and execute contracts.
- Assist in the development and maintenance of estimating resource database, guidelines and resource information on products, vendors, subcontractors, and government requirements.
- Strict adherence to the BA Blacktop Group of Companies’ corporate safety standards and procedures.
- Annual participation in a corporate safety orientation.
- Coordinates with Safety Officer to ensure ongoing compliance with client safety, requirements, and completion of safety prequalification’s, NOP’s, etc.
- Meets all project tender deadlines.
- Consistently delivers a solid, defendable estimate for the bid review process.
- Minimum of 8+ years of industry experience.
- Proven track record in both Estimating & Project Management Roles.
- Thorough understanding with applied knowledge of construction earthwork, structures, paving, underground, and grading practices on large /complex heavy civil projects.
- Excellent technical, communication, organizational, managerial, and planning skills.
- Excellent relational and leadership skills.
- Ability to identify and analyze problems and provide solutions.
- Require very limited supervision and direction beyond providing desired outcomes.
- Ability to learn new software including: B2W estimating, Autodesk NavisWorks, Autodesk, MS Excel, etc.
- Accredited 4-year degree in a related field or applicable discipline; CET Diploma; or equivalent experience.
- Gold Seal Certificate – Estimating.
- Applied Civil Sciences, Project Management.
- Construction-related courses offered by VRCA / BCIT.
- Time Management Training .
- Communications Training.
